What Affects Estate Planning Cost in Pueblo?

Package

Basic (will + POA + directive): $500-$1,500. With living trust: $1,500-$3,500. Complex estate: $3,000-$7,000+

DIY

Online services: $200-$600. Attorney-reviewed online: $400-$1,000

Tips to Save on Estate Planning in Pueblo

  • 1.Basic will + POA + healthcare directive is sufficient for most people
  • 2.Online services (LegalZoom, Trust & Will) cost $200-$600 for simple estates
  • 3.Many attorneys offer estate planning packages at a flat rate
  • 4.Review and update every 3-5 years rather than creating from scratch

Do I need a trust?

A trust avoids probate and provides privacy. It's recommended if you own property, have assets over $100K, have minor children, or want to control how assets are distributed after death.
